Vegan Chicken

Method

Vegan Chicken

1

Prepare jackfruit

Drain and rinse jackfruit. Use your fingers or two forks to pull and shred the larger pieces into fibrous, chicken-like strands until you have about 2 cups of shredded jackfruit.

2

Make seitan-like base

In a mixing bowl, combine vital wheat gluten, chickpea flour, smoked pa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, black pepper and 1 tsp salt. Add shredded jackfruit and toss to coat. In a separate bowl whisk together 1/2 cup vegetable broth and 2 tablespoons soy sauce. Pour the wet into the dry and mix until a stretchy dough forms (about 1–2 minutes); knead briefly in the bowl for 30–60 seconds so the gluten develops and binds the jackfruit.

3

Form pieces

Divide the mixture into 4 equal portions and shape each into a flattened patty roughly the size of your buns (about 1/2 inch thick). Cover and let rest 10 minutes to relax the gluten.

4

Steam (optional for chew)

For a firmer, chewier texture, steam the patties in a steamer basket over simmering water for 12 minutes, then let cool slightly. (If short on time you can skip steaming and proceed directly to breading/frying.)

Breading & Frying

5

Setup dredging station

In one shallow dish combine flour, cornstarch, salt and pepper. In a second bowl whisk plant milk with apple cider vinegar to make a quick vegan buttermilk. In a third bowl place panko breadcrumbs.

6

Bread patties

Working one piece at a time, press each patty into the flour mixture to coat, dip into the plant-milk mixture, then press into panko until well coated. For extra crispness, repeat the dip-and-coat once more.

7

Fry patties

Heat 1/2 cup neutral oil in a large skillet over medium heat until shimmering. Add 2 tablespoons olive oil for flavor if desired. Fry the patties 3–4 minutes per side, flipping gently, until golden brown and crisp. Drain on a paper towel-lined tray. If patties were steamed first, frying time may be shorter (2–3 minutes per side).

8

Optional oven finish

To ensure internal heat and melt vegan cheese, place fried patties on a baking sheet, top each with a vegan cheese slice, and bake at 375°F (190°C) for 4–6 minutes until cheese softens and patties are heated through.

Vegan Cheese & Sauce

9

Make sandwich sauce

In a small bowl whisk together vegan mayo, smoky hot sauce, lemon juice, maple syrup, garlic powder and 1/4 tsp salt until smooth. Taste and adjust seasoning; set aside in refrigerator until ready to assemble.

10

Prepare cheese

If using slices, keep them refrigerated until oven finish step so they soften and melt on hot patties. If using shreds you can sprinkle them directly on hot patties in the oven or briefly under a broiler (watch carefully).

Sandwich Build

11

Toast buns

Spread vegan butter or a little oil on cut sides of 4 buns. Toast in a skillet over medium heat or under a broiler until golden and slightly crisp, about 1–2 minutes per side.

12

Assemble sandwiches

Spread about 1 tablespoon of the prepared sauce on both top and bottom bun halves. Place a handful (about 1/2 cup) of shredded iceberg on the bottom bun, top with a hot vegan chicken patty with melted cheese, add pickles if using, then more sauce if desired and the top bun. Repeat for remaining sandwiches.

13

Serve

Serve immediately while patties are hot and cheese is melty. Offer extra sauce on the side.
